More About The Name Eero
The name Eero has several possible meanings. It is derived from the Old Norse name Eiríkr, which means "eternal ruler." It can also be associated with the word 'ēriks,' which means "sole ruler" or "ever powerful" in Old High German.
Regarding famous personalities with the name Eero, there are a few notable individuals:
1. Eero Aarnio: A Finnish interior designer and architect famous for his innovative and iconic furniture designs, including the "Ball Chair" and "Bubble Chair."
2. Eero Saarinen: A renowned Finnish-American architect known for his modernist designs, including the TWA Flight Center at John F. Kennedy International Airport and the Gateway Arch in St. Louis.
3. Eero Heinäluoma: A Finnish politician who served as the Minister of Finance and later as the Speaker of the Finnish Parliament.
